Peyton Hillis Passes Matt Ryan in Madden 12 Vote--Jamaal Charles Up Next

In somewhat of a stunning upset, Cleveland Browns running back Peyton Hillis has moved on in the Madden 12 cover voting over Atlanta Falcons quarterback Matt Ryan, and will now face fellow breakout star running back Jamaal Charles of the Kansas City Chiefs.

Hillis is wildly popular among NFL fans, especially those in Cleveland and Denver for his powerful style of play, and the fact that he never gives up on a play and can do so many things well. He is truly a fun player to watch, and while he is still relatively new to stardom in the NFL, he would be a fun player to see on the cover of the Madden video game.

↵

Hillis took 51 percent of the vote, and faces a tough task now with the Chiefs’ Jamaal Charles. Charles had a breakout year for the Chiefs in 2010, and is one of the more exciting players in the league. This should be an excellent matchup of players.
